Michelle Gartner from Smart, Not Cheap, tagged me awhile ago to participate in the Moolanomy My One Piece of Money Advice Meme. Sorry it’s so late, but here it goes.
If I could offer one piece of money advice, it would be to PAY YOURSELF FIRST! I’m sure you’ve all heard it before, but how many of you actually do it? To the max? Maybe you contribute a bit to your 401K, but do you contribute enough to get your full company match? That’s free money! Do you have any going into savings as well?

We have been a 4-H family for 3 yrs now and raise chickens to show in the summer fair. Our oldest Emily is an intermediate in 4-H this year (turns 12 tomorrrow!) our middle daughter Shannon is still a Primary in 4-H this year, and our youngest Megan is just turning 6 in August, so she will become an official 4-H member this fall.

Emily, Shannon & Megan inside our newest bird pen4-H has been a great project for our family. Not only have the girls learned resonsibility, record keeping, and a ton about poultry, but they have made some wonderful friendships. It’s great fun to see the poultry kids come together and share their knowledge.
